Explore the historic Daweswood House Museum, the former country residence of Arboretum cofounders Beman and Bertie Dawes, with a guided tour.
With several rooms preserved for accuracy, take a peek into the lives of our founding family. Daweswood House Museum tours will be available May through October,Wednesday through Sunday at 12pm and 2pm. Tours will begin on the front porch of the Daweswood House Museum.
